准备工作 1. 安装git 2. 创建一个ssh密钥 如果已经有ssh密钥了,则这一步不要执行 3. 复制公钥内容 复制文件的内容 1. 添加到ssh and GPG keys 打开github,在设置里里面找到ssh and GPG keys,然后添加id_rsa.pub内容 本地工作 有两种方式 ...
分类:
其他好文 时间:
2018-01-21 17:35:57
阅读次数:
174
原理: 公钥私钥匹配通过验证,允许访问服务器。 简单步骤: 执行到第3步,现在其实已经可以不同过密码进行访问服务器了,但是还是需要记住IP比较麻烦。 具体操作: 1. 在本地机器创建密钥 2.将公钥传到需要访问的服务器上,并加入authorized_keys文件中 3.创建别名快捷登录 以后执行运行 ...
分类:
其他好文 时间:
2018-01-17 18:24:21
阅读次数:
172
之前在Linux中已经生成了ssh密钥对,并且也配置好了与GitHub仓库的连接,然后想在windows上也连接一下GitHub仓库,于是把生成好的私钥先存储到windows上的一个文件夹中,接着打开gitbash:然后把私钥文件移动到git的ssh目录下:$mvE:/git_ssh_key/id_rsa~/.ssh$ls~/.sshid_rsaknown_hosts接着就可以直接进行身份验证了:
分类:
其他好文 时间:
2018-01-14 20:18:31
阅读次数:
197
1、SSH协议的认识 SSH 为 Secure Shell 的缩写,由 IETF 的网络小组(Network Working Group)所制定;SSH 为建立在应用层基础上的安全协议。SSH 是目前较可靠,专为远程登录会话和其他网络服务提供安全性的协议。利用 SSH 协议可以有效防止远程管理过程中 ...
分类:
系统相关 时间:
2018-01-11 16:11:31
阅读次数:
232
许多 Git 服务器都使用 SSH 公钥进行认证。 为了向 Git 服务器提供 SSH 公钥,如果某系统用户尚未拥有密钥,必须事先为其生成一份。 这个过程在所有操作系统上都是相似的。 首先,你需要确认自己是否已经拥有密钥。 默认情况下,用户的 SSH 密钥存储在其 ~/.ssh 目录下。 进入该目录 ...
分类:
其他好文 时间:
2018-01-05 12:32:44
阅读次数:
263
本地项目上传到Github总结: 1、在本地创建一个版本库(即文件夹),通过git init把它变成Git仓库; 2、把项目复制到这个文件夹里面,再通过git add .把项目添加到仓库; 3、再通过git commit -m "注释内容"把项目提交到仓库; 4、在Github上设置好SSH密钥后, ...
分类:
Web程序 时间:
2017-12-30 17:01:14
阅读次数:
188
摘要:centos7, xshell, 公钥, ssh ssh登录方式有口令认证登录和密钥认证登录 接下来本次介绍是ssh密钥登录方式 (1)产生公钥 (2)将公钥放置到centos7的(/root/./ssh)目录中 (3)然后添加ssh用户 因为我下载的xshell以中文,产生公钥的过程如图: ...
分类:
其他好文 时间:
2017-12-29 23:32:32
阅读次数:
1140
Linux ssh密钥登录和取消密钥登录 2016-05-18? linux技巧 ? 暂无评论 在VPS中利用vi编辑器编辑sshd的配置文件 vi /etc/ssh/sshd_config 找到 RSAAuthentication和PubkeyAuthentication 两行,并将前面的“#”去 ...
分类:
系统相关 时间:
2017-12-20 20:23:40
阅读次数:
674
Git是分布式的代码管理工具,远程的代码管理是基于SSH的,所以要使用远程的Git则需要SSH的配置。 github的SSH配置如下: 一 、 设置Git的user name和email: 二、生成SSH密钥过程:1.查看是否已经有了ssh密钥:cd ~/.ssh如果没有密钥则不会有此文件夹,有则备 ...
分类:
其他好文 时间:
2017-12-14 04:02:46
阅读次数:
120